It depends on your receiver. Assuming you have a 5.1 analog input on your receiver (otherwise you might want to upgrade), you connect the six first plugs (FL/SL/C + FR/SR/SW) to your analog inputs using any regular RCA-terminated coax cables. Ignore the SBL and SBR, which are for 7.1. The player can "downmix" source 7.1 into 5.1 without sweating.

I have a similar problem and put the money into the projector. Cheaper to run two long HDMI cables to the PJ and two short optical cables to the Denon, than to replace the AVR and still need one long HDMI. PLUS - with two separate inputs you can set up distinct settings for each input device on the PJ. Mine vary greatly for the cable box to PS3.
Just an option, but I'm off the new AVR wagon for a while as it just adds nothing now.
